BIO
Martin Šlampa is an attorney at FORLEX. He specialises in litigation and is a registered mediator. He represents clients in a wide range of commercial disputes as well as in administrative proceedings and proceedings before administrative courts. He also focuses on representing clients in tax disputes with the tax administration.
Martin Šlampa has represented clients in, among others, disputes arising from contracts for works (including multi-million-dollar arbitrations concerning major investment units), protection against unfair competition, damage claims for breach of competition law, corporate disputes between shareholders and many others. Martin Šlampa also participated in the development of the practice of representing clients in tax disputes with the tax administration and successfully defended clients' rights in the area of income tax, VAT and excise taxes.
Martin Šlampa began his professional career as an assistant to Judge Jan Passer of the Supreme Administrative Court (currently a judge of the Court of Justice of the EU). Subsequently, he worked for six years at HAVEL & PARTNERS as an associate, attorney and then senior attorney. Subsequently, he worked as the head of the legal department at České přístavy, a.s. and as a senior counsel at Liberty Ostrava a.s., where he dealt mainly with contractual matters and disputes arising from commercial and energy law. After returning to the bar, he joined forces with FORLEX to further develop our litigation agenda, including administrative court proceedings and tax disputes.
